Out with Matt Riddle and in with Matt Brown (Pictured). On Wednesday morning, “The Immortal” announced he will now face Luis Ramos at “UFC on FX: Maynard vs. Guida.”
“Just signed and sent bout agreement to fight Luis Ramos June 22nd in Atlantic City,” Brown tweeted.
No word on why Riddle was forced to withdraw from his welterweight affair with Ramos. It marks the second time in four outings that he’s had to pull out of a contest.
Since being on the wrong end of a three-fight streak, Brown has managed to rattle off three wins in his past four bouts. The former “The Ultimate Fighter 7” contestant was most recently seen taking a decision victory over Stephen Thompson at UFC 145.
Ramos’s big league debut was a brief one. The Brazilian was knockout out in 40 seconds by Erick Silva at UFC 134. “Beicao” had won three straight prior to the lights out loss.
Revel in Atlantic City, New Jersey hosts the June 22nd event. FX will broadcast the main card live beginning at 9PM ET/6PM PT.
Brown vs. Ramos will appear in the preliminary portion of the festivities, which airs live on FUEL TV at 6PM ET/3PM PT.
